disturbance of association

interruption of a logical chain of culturally accepted thought, leading to apparently confused and haphazard thinking that is difficult for others to comprehend. It is one of the fundamental symptoms of schizophrenia described by Eugen Bleuler. See also schizophrenic thinking; thought disorder.
